Brass has one other, less well known, advantage over titanium. It is anti-microbial because of the copper in it. Just food for thought with your decision process.
Is there a notable difference in the perceived temperature of the two materials? Brass conducts heat very well whereas titanium does not so I would expect brass to feel colder.
